Soy Crop Area Expanding in Argentina

02.21.08

Soybean crops in Argentina now occupy more than half of the country's cropland, covering 16.9 million ha or 4 percent more than last year, according to estimates published by La Nacion.

However, the 2008 harvest is expected to be the same in size as 2007, about 47 million mt, because the larger area will only compensate for a widespread drop in yield caused by lack of rain.

Argentina is the world's third largest soybean producer, as well as the biggest producer and exporter of soybean oil globally, with an estimated 95% of its production traded abroad.
